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Inspection
Catching water damage issues early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age. Look for these warning signs and don't hesitate to call us if you notice any of them.
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show mold growth or hidden water damage. Don't ignore the smell it could be a sign of a more serious issue.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
Warped or discolored flooring can show water damage or high moisture levels. Address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don't delay in addressing the issue.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ings can show water damage or leaks. Act quickly to prevent further damage.
Mold Growth or Black Spots
Mold growth or black spots can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don't risk your health address the issue quickly.

Water Damage Inspection Cost in Aberdeen, OH
The cost of water damage inspection var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Estimates are provided after an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to find out the best course of action.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Moisture detection and inspection | $200 - $1,000 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Containment and drying | $500 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of drying equipment used, and duration of drying process |
| Repair and restoration | $1,000 - $10,000 | Scope of work, materials needed, and labor costs |
| Water damage assessment and reporting | $100 - $500 | Complexity of the issue and time required for assessment |
| Follow-up and repair | $500 - $2,000 | Scope of work, materials needed, and labor costs |
Exact pricing depends on the specifics of your situation and an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to find out the best course of action.
